Wife and I had originally planned to go to another ramen restaurant for lunch but we hit a bit of snag with our errands at Fairview so we settled with Yoi located in the food court. In terms of ramen, you get a decent bowl with 3 decently thick slices of meat and a runny egg (I've encountered other ramen restaurants that mess this up) plus all the other typical toppings. For the noodles, they were your standard yellow chewy variety. My wife likes softer noodles for ramen but we found the noodles softened up the longer it was sat in the soup. For $12.99 it's actually pretty decent especially when most other places charge $16-20 per bowl these days.
I had the chicken katsu burger which wasn't on their menu a few years ago. It was a decent sized sandwich with a crispy dark meat cutlet, a soft good quality bun and a generous portion of veggies and pickles to balance it out. It also came with a side of furikake fries which was good too.
Overall - probably the best food stall in the food court...
